Grasping Hunter ICV Valves
Hunter ICV valves function a crucial role in regulating the passage of liquid in irrigation installations. They provide precise adjustment of watering schedules, optimizing plant growth and saving water assets.
An ICV valve features a system that responds to the force of the water supply. This permits the valve to regulate precisely, guaranteeing a uniform flow of liquid.
Let's explore the essential parts of a Hunter ICV valve:
* The body: This holds the inner components.
* The seal: This sensitive component reacts to the liquid pressure.
* The spring: This provides the resistance to the diaphragm, allowing precise manipulation.
Comprehending these components and their operation is vital for proper installation, maintenance, and troubleshooting of Hunter ICV valves.

Tips for Fixing a Hunter ICV Valve
Keeping your Hunter ICV valve in tip-top shape is crucial for optimal irrigation performance. Regularly inspect your valves for any signs of wear and tear, such as cracks, leaks, or corrosion. Verify the valve diaphragm is properly seated and replace it if worn. Clean the strainer regularly to prevent debris from obstructing water flow.
Inspect your valve for leaks by slowly opening the faucet connected to it. If a leak is detected, tighten any loose connections or replace faulty components. Lubricate moving parts with a silicone-based lubricant to ensure smooth operation.
- Consult your Hunter ICV valve’s user manual for specific repair and maintenance instructions.
- Follow all safety precautions when working with irrigation systems, including disconnecting the power supply before servicing.
